I'm not entirely sure what you are asking as you mention SMI.

You ESA claim started in 2011 and as far as I can see has been continuous since then.

A reassessment is not a new application for ESA but you need to treat it as one as there is usually no reference back to a previous assessment, so you can't just say "no change".

The SMI is totally separate and may or may not correspond with your ESA claim.

I can only tell you what I did with regard to putting in claim for SMI (C/Tax), which was to telephone the DWP and asked if they could send me written confirmation of when I first commenced claiming.

Due to the various changes eg., Invalidity Benefit, Incapacity Benefit, ESA I think they send me letter regarding each benefit to enable the Council Tax people to have the proof that they required.
